I found most of the plot predictable, and based on that would 3.5 it. But the characters and the dragons bump it to a 4. I really enjoyed the war college aspect, and loved that the FMC didn't automatically become amazing at everything. Finally, the banter between dark and broody and the strong willed FMC is what ya girl loves.
